Kerr Binns Vase, Cosimo de' Medici

A Kerr Binns Worcester vase with a cartouche of Cosimo de' Medici on the main face, lavishly set in a gilded frame, jewelled on the borders. A crest is on the reverse, satyr masks to the shoulders. The enamel decoration attributed to Thomas Bott, Snr. The Kerr Binns factory mark to the underside.
In very good antique condition, just tiny losses to the gilding, one on the inside of the opening, the porcelain body showing no damage.

Size: 15 cm high, 11.5 cm at the widest.

Cosimo di Giovanni de' Medici (1389 – 1464) was an Italian banker and politician who established the Medici family as effective rulers of Florence during the Italian Renaissance. His power derived from his wealth as a banker and intermarriage with other rich and powerful families. He was a patron of arts, learning, and architecture, spending lavishly on art and culture.
